Output 3d3785770e32ce9872fb8c09b366985eae62c4b966161d6574bbf19a8b3bfea0:4

value
1017685828
script pubkey
OP_0 OP_PUSHBYTES_20 36a68360b4e7e94645cd35882f9043fcfd32cc69
address
ltc1qx6ngxc95ul55v3wdxkyzlyzrln7n9nrfuk6ehj
transaction
3d3785770e32ce9872fb8c09b366985eae62c4b966161d6574bbf19a8b3bfea0
spent
true